1201352129 has 2 divisors, whose sum is σ = 1201352130. Its totient is φ = 1201352128.

The previous prime is 1201352063. The next prime is 1201352147. The reversal of 1201352129 is 9212531021.

It is a happy number.

It is a strong prime.

It can be written as a sum of positive squares in only one way, i.e., 796537729 + 404814400 = 28223^2 + 20120^2 .

It is a cyclic number.

It is not a de Polignac number, because 1201352129 - 224 = 1184574913 is a prime.

It is a junction number, because it is equal to n+sod(n) for n = 1201352098 and 1201352107.

It is not a weakly prime, because it can be changed into another prime (1201352429) by changing a digit.

It is a polite number, since it can be written as a sum of consecutive naturals, namely, 600676064 + 600676065.

It is an arithmetic number, because the mean of its divisors is an integer number (600676065).

Almost surely, 21201352129 is an apocalyptic number.

It is an amenable number.

1201352129 is a deficient number, since it is larger than the sum of its proper divisors (1).

1201352129 is an equidigital number, since it uses as much as digits as its factorization.

1201352129 is an evil number, because the sum of its binary digits is even.

The product of its (nonzero) digits is 1080, while the sum is 26.

The square root of 1201352129 is about 34660.5269579099. The cubic root of 1201352129 is about 1063.0575447762.

The spelling of 1201352129 in words is "one billion, two hundred one million, three hundred fifty-two thousand, one hundred twenty-nine".
